Latest Patents

Among his latest patents is an innovative apparatus and method for the analysis of porous materials. This apparatus is designed to determine the inner condition of a porous material, especially a textile material web. It features a pressure element and an extracting and collecting element that clamp the material between them. The clamped sample is then extracted using a preferably hot extracting fluid. The resulting extract is analyzed to provide insights into the inner condition of the material and any substances present in or on it. Another notable patent is a sensor device for a machine that measures conductive parts mounted on a structure. This device includes a sensor connected to a movable housing by an elastically deformable mechanism, which is integrated into an electric circuit.
